Hi Branch names can contain slashes, so we can use 'development/foo' as a branch name. If I choose 'development' as a branch name, it doesn't work. There is a directory named development at '.git/refs/heads' directory. So we cannot create a file named development for 'refs/heads/development'. An error message may occurs like below. Unfortunately, It is not of help to me. 'error: 'refs/heads/development/foo' exists; cannot create 'refs/heads/development'.
